The Senior Design Manager will oversee the development, preparation, and management of project engineering documentation for successful delivery of all engineering activities, with initial focus on key assets for Phase 1 of THE LINE, particularly the museum.
This role involves developing strategies, plans, schedules, risk mitigation, resource management, stakeholder communication, and ensuring compliance with NEOM standards. The manager will lead a team of engineers, subject matter experts, secondees, and consultants, reporting to the Project Manager/Director and the Director of Engineering Management, ensuring project milestones and strategic objectives are met.
The role requires close collaboration with NEOM sectors and stakeholders to ensure engineering outcomes are effectively communicated and delivered. The Senior Design Manager must perform duties professionally, support project timelines, and adhere to formal instructions.
Key Responsibilities
& Accountabilities
Develop and manage engineering strategies, plans, schedules, and risk management frameworks.
Provide engineering expertise and guidance to ensure effective project outcomes.
Ensure compliance with NEOM codes, standards, and practices.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ams including project managers, architects, consultants, and contractors.
Drive engineering success, foster innovation, and deliver fit-for-purpose solutions.
Monitor and report on engineering progress.
Prepare scopes of work and evaluate technical proposals.
Manage team performance and project outcomes, ensuring alignment with objectives.
Background,
Skills & Qualifications
Over 15 years of engineering experience, including at least 5 years in senior or director roles, with 6 years in project management or leadership.
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Master Planning, Engineering, or equivalent.
Proven leadership in managing engineering offices for major contractors, consultants, or developers.
Strong problem-solving, negotiation, and leadership skills.
Excellent communication and ability to work under pressure.
GCC experience and museum design/operation experience are desirable.
